Harlan makes a snack mix with proportional amounts of cereal and popcorn.
The graph shows how much popcorn he uses with different amounts of cereal to the snack mix.
According to the question
Harlan makes a snack mix with proportional amounts of cereal and popcorn.
1. The amount of popcorn in the graph is 2 and the amount of cereal is 1.
Then,
The number of cups of popcorn is used per cup of cereal is determined by
[tex]\rm = \dfrac{The \ amount \ of \ popcorn}{The \ amount \ of \ cereal}\\\\= \dfrac{2}{1}\\\\= 2[/tex]
Harlem uses 2 cups of popcorn per cup of cereal.
2. The amount of popcorn in the graph is 2 and the amount of cereal is 1.
Then,
The number of cups of cereal is used per cup popcorn of is determined by
[tex]\rm = \dfrac{The \ amount \ of \ cereal}{The \ amount \ of \ popcorn}\\\\= \dfrac{1}{2}\\\\= 0.5[/tex]
Harlem uses 0.5 cup of cereal per cup of popcorn.
